Caprine
Caprine

Description: Caprine is an open-source, free desktop application for Facebook Messenger. It is available on Windows, macOS and Linux. Caprine offers a lightweight and customizable alternative to using Facebook Messenger in the browser.

Caprine
Caprine
Pros
  • Open-source and free to use
  • Provides a lightweight alternative to the browser-based Facebook Messenger
  • Offers end-to-end encryption for enhanced privacy
  • Customizable interface and theming options
  • Supports cross-platform compatibility
Cons
  • Limited features compared to the official Facebook Messenger app
  • Doesn't support all the latest features and updates from Facebook Messenger
  • Relies on the Facebook Messenger API, which may change over time
